The global go-kart market is shifting toward "Smart Electrification." Unlike traditional internal combustion engines, modern motorized go-karts utilize advanced Brushless DC (BLDC) motors and high-energy density lithium batteries, offering superior torque curves and zero local emissions. This evolution is driven by urban noise regulations and the industrial push for green entertainment venues.
